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ional mounting systems for flat-panel displays lack adjustability and flexibility, making it difficult to achieve optimal viewing positions and orientations without tools, and are not well-suited for video wall applications where precise alignment and uniform positioning of multiple displays are required.
Innovation Solution
The development of adjustable mounting systems that allow for tool-free adjustment of display position and orientation in multiple degrees of freedom, featuring a surface bracket, extension arm assembly, mount carriage, and device bracket assemblies, enabling independent translation and rotation of displays relative to the mounting surface, with components that can be easily accessed and adjusted in extended positions for service.

A mounting system for mounting a display device to a surface, the mounting system adjustable in multiple degrees of freedom to selectively position and orientate the attached device relative to the mounting surface and/or other collocated display devices. According to various embodiments, a surface bracket is configured to attach to a mounting surface and an arm assembly operatively couples the surface bracket with a mount carriage. A mount bracket is movably coupled to the mount carriage and is selectively movable in a plane substantially parallel to the surface. A plurality of device bracket assemblies are coupled to the mount bracket. Each of the device bracket assemblies is selectively movable to translate, pivot and tilt the attached device.
